Your Malheur County property assessment will jump to market value at purchase under Oregon's Measure 50, resetting the 3% annual growth cap — expect a significant increase from the prior owner's tax bill. Malheur County does not provide a county homestead exemption, but the Malheur County Assessor administers senior citizen and disabled person exemptions for qualifying owners; verify income and residency requirements early. Apply for exemptions directly with the Malheur County Assessor within 30 days of purchase to secure relief for the current tax year.
